Nebia Shower - Better experience, 70% less water
Atomizing nozzles use pressure and geometry to control the dispersion and break up of fluid streams. These nozzles have been developed over the last century for specific technical applications, such as injecting fuel, powderizing metal, and efficient agricultural irrigation. While regular shower nozzles, called plain orifice nozzles, produce a straight stream of water with large droplets, our atomizing nozzles produce 100s of droplets dispersed into precise patterns.

Nebia’s greater dispersion of droplets yields a larger volume of air surrounded by - and intermixed with - warm droplets of water. Therefore, the warm droplets heat a larger volume of air faster and more efficiently. The nozzle geometries are engineered to release droplets at different sizes and speeds. At any given cross-section of air between the nozzles and you, Nebia comprises 100s more droplets dispersed over 5 times the area compared to a regular shower. Translation: water completely surrounds and gets you wet all while using 70% less water. It’s not magic; it’s science! Let?s look at examples to compare.
